New Pass Idea: Skyscale Sanctuary Pass


Recommended Posts

In order to preserve the Skyscale species, Gorrik and other scientists, researchers, and conservationists have found a perfect spot for the new Skyscales to multiply and grow. It is a floating island above __ (Core Tyria Map). There is an Atrium with incubation and medical equipment to keep the skyscale population healthy.

Features:

  1. In the atrium, you can play with the hatchlings like you do with the ball/flute in the Sun's Refuge
  2. The outside parts of the island you can play hide and seek and catch with the larger skyscales.
  3. you can mount a skyscale even if you don't have one (just like the dragonfall map)
  4. all trade vendors, crafting stations and city ports available.
  5. Ability to mark one place in Tyria to which you can port to. Fly a skyscale through a specific portal/rift
  6. Infinite Flight within a certain radius of the island
